366 rhino poachers arrested in Kruger National Park since start of 2018
While 366 alleged rhino poachers were arrested in the Kruger National Park since the start of last year, 472 white rhinos were poached in the park between April 1, 2018, and July 31, 2019. This was revealed in Environment, Forestry and Fisheries Minister Barbara Creecy’s reply to a written parliamentary question by DA MP James […]
Poacher gets 37 years for killing mom and baby rhino
MHALA – A rhino poacher who killed a cow and her baby rhino in 2015 was sentenced to an effective 30 years in prison on Wednesday. Norman Khoza (35) was convicted on eight poaching and firearm-related charges in the Mhala Regional Court. The two rhinos were poached at Nwanetse in the Kruger National Park. Khoza […]

Rhino poacher killed by an elephant and then ‘devoured’ by lions
A rhino poacher is believed to have been attacked by an elephant and then eaten by a pride of lions during an incident in South Africa’s Kruger national park. Police brigadier Leonard Hlathi said police received information that a group of men had gone into the park on 1 April in order to hunt rhino, […]
